Winnipeg and the prairie pulse
Long winter nights meet endless enthusiasm, producing packed bonspiels and crisp, consistent ice. Locals swap stories about marathon draws and improbable last-rock doubles. If you crave volume, variety, and community pride, Winnipeg’s curling calendar will overflow your planner.
Calgary, Edmonton, and championship energy
Western Canada’s arenas often host major events, pairing fast ice with roaring crowds who know every strategy call. Between draws, explore mountain day trips and coffee spots where players dissect angles like chess grandmasters comparing endgame notes.
Maritime warmth, rock-solid hospitality
From Nova Scotia to Newfoundland, Atlantic clubs blend sharp competition with open-armed welcome. Expect kitchen-party laughter after last stone, fiddle tunes somewhere nearby, and locals eager to guide visitors toward their favorite coastal walks and hidden bakery treasures.

Scotland: Roots of the Roaring Game

Perth’s clubs cherish rituals that shaped curling’s spirit: fairness, camaraderie, and respect. Walk past trophy cabinets, then step onto ice where whispers of strategy meet the soft brush of brooms. You’ll feel why so many pilgrimages begin here.

Nordic Precision: Sweden, Norway, and Switzerland

Sweden’s culture of craft

Clubs in cities like Karlstad showcase rigorous coaching, smart systems, and supportive communities. Visiting players note the fast, true ice that rewards clean releases and patient strategy. Expect clinics, friendly sparring, and post-game analysis that sharpens your competitive edge.

Norway’s inventive edge

From coastal hubs to winter towns, Norwegian curling blends playful creativity with disciplined execution. You’ll hear inventive line calls, see fearless runbacks, and meet volunteers who obsess over pebble quality like artisans tuning violins before a concert.

Switzerland’s alpine allure

Rising Stars Across Asia

Karuizawa, Japan: Olympic echoes

Karuizawa hosted Olympic curling in the late nineties, and the area’s quiet charm endures. Expect immaculate facilities, courteous club culture, and nearby hot springs that soothe sweeping arms after tight ends. Local cuisine refuels you for morning practice sessions.

Gangneung, South Korea: modern showcase

The Gangneung venue radiates Olympic pedigree, combining sleek design with sharp ice that rewards precision sweeping. After draws, explore seaside markets and coffee streets. You’ll meet fans who learned strategy by cheering nervy last-rock shots during winter’s biggest stage.

Beijing, China: big-stage ambition

United States Curling Road Trip

Duluth’s club culture is famously welcoming, balancing serious competition with bonspiel whimsy. After a game, you’ll hear locals debate the perfect broom angle over burgers. Lake air, friendly ice crews, and lively schedules make it a repeat-worthy stop.

Planning Your Curling Pilgrimage

Research prime months for each region, book ice well ahead, and target bonspiels or open houses that match your level. Faster championship ice requires practice; cozy club nights prioritize fun. Build buffer days for weather, sightseeing, and recovery.
